我有一个简单的HTML页面,仅在我的Intranet上的本地计算机上使用,以使用Javascript和ActiveX创建动态SQL查询以与我的SQL Server数据库进行交互(是的,客户端Javascript可以使用IE和SQL Server与SQL数据库进行交互。 ActiveX对象)。它最初是作为一种快速的短期解决方案而创建的(我知道它是不安全的,并且客户端DB访问是一种不良做法)。

情况已经改变,我需要一个永久的解决方案。我已经决定,ASP.NET MVC应用程序将是最干净的解决方案。我没有使用它的经验,所以我一直在阅读并使用教程来开始构建我的页面。我的问题与原始应用程序中的Javascript动态SQL查询逻辑有关,以及如何最好地在.NET应用程序中实现它。是否有一种干净安全的方法在ASP.NET MVC中创建动态SQL查询(使用C#/原始SQL代码/ADO.NET)?还是使用实体框架并从头开始的最佳实践?

最佳答案

如果性能无关紧要或您的数据库很小,请从头开始使用EF。

关于javascript - 如何将用于访问SQL Server的HTML + Javascript页面转换为ASP.NET MVC应用程序?,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/42411874/

10-12 00:30
查看更多